The Bosch Rexroth Indramat MAC093B-0-GS-4-C/130-A-0/WI521LV/S009 from the MAC AC Servo Motors series combines precision and reliability in a compact package. This AC Servo Motor MAC is built around a size 93 frame and features a length B housing that measures a centering diameter of 130 mm in B05/B14 design. Weighing just 16.5 Kg, it remains light enough for high-density installations while offering the ruggedness demanded by industrial environments. The motor delivers its power through a dedicated power connection side A, ensuring straightforward wiring during assembly.
At its core, the drive employs an incremental encoder with standard mounting for accurate position feedback, complemented by a standard tacho type output that produces 1.5 V per 1000 min⁻¹. Continuous torque at standstill reaches 14.5 (20.0) Nm, driven by a nominal current of 38 (53) A at standstill and supported by a thermal time constant of 50 (45) min, which allows the motor to withstand intermittent high-load cycles without thermal overrun. Natural convection cooling maintains optimal temperature without additional hardware, while a winding inductance of 2.0 mH ensures stable current control and reduced electrical noise.
